NARS Sheer Glow Foundation in Fiji - NARS Sheer Glow is suited for normal to dry skin types. I decided to get the Sheeer Glow rather than the Sheer Matte Foundation as I have heard that the latter results in dry patchy finishes and does not provide any oil-control. Sheer Glow applies on really smooth and gives a lovely dewy glow to my skin, however, towards the end of the day my skin did appear slightly oily along the T-zone and the longevity was substandard. What I liked about this foundation is how well it blended onto my skin and the colour match was almost perfect. 

Dior Diorskin Forever Compact in 020 - This Diorskin powder contains SPF25 PA++ which is a great quality of this powder. The powder mattifies my skin very well after applying foundation, however I do feel that sometimes my skin looks a little heavy. So, the key thing to remember is to apply minimal powder to achieve naturally matte-looking skin.

L'Occitane Luminous Body Cream with olive tree extracts - This body cream smells okay, the scent of products containing olive extracts aren't really my type of scent. Despite this, the texture is really smooth and rich and also very hydrating! It doesn't look obvious when you look at the cream in the jar, however, after application, I noticed hundreds and thousands of miniscule sparkles on my hand and skin. So, this product was great to wear on a night out.
